Abciximab (ReoPro) as a Therapeutic Intervention for Sickle Cell Vaso-Occlusive Pain Crisis
RandomizedParallel-groupTriple-blindTreatment
Summary
The purpose of this study is to determine whether giving abciximab (ReoPro) to children with sickle cell disease who are hospitalized for acute pain crisis will improve their pain and shorten the time spent in the hospital, when compared with standard supportive care.
